Emergency Window Repair: A Comprehensive Guide
Windows are vital elements of any building, permitting light and ventilation while providing views of the outside world. However, when windows get harmed due to mishaps, severe weather conditions, or use and tear, timely repair is essential to keep convenience, security, and energy effectiveness. This short article delves into the information of emergency window repair, describing when it's required, what the process involves, and how to perform it efficiently.
Understanding Emergency Window Repair
Emergency window repair refers to the fast and often short-term repairs required when a window is suddenly damaged. Conditions that necessitate such repair work may include:
Broken Glass: After an effect (e.g., from hail or a falling tree branch).Frame Damage: Caused by strong winds or collisions.Water Leaks: Resulting from a failing seal or broken frame.Weather Stripping Wear: Leading to drafts and energy loss.
Proper understanding of these problems can guide house owners in taking the best steps towards resolving them.
When is Emergency Window Repair Necessary?
Recognizing the signs that suggest urgent repair is vital. Property owners must be alert about the following signs:
Cracked or Shattered Glass: If the glass is broken, it can position security risks.Increased Energy Bills: Drafts and air leakages can cause ineffective heating or cooling.Noticeable Damage to the Frame: Cracks, splits, or warping should be resolved instantly.Foggy or Cloudy Windows: This may show seal failure, leading to moisture caught within.Water Stains Around Windows: Indicate a potential leak that can cause mold development.Threats of Delaying Repairs

If a house owner finds themselves dealing with a window emergency, there are a number of actions to follow:
Immediate Safety MeasuresAssess the Damage: Determine the level of the damage to focus on repair work.Clear the Area: Remove neighboring furnishings or challenge make sure safety.Wear Safety Gear: If there's broken glass, gloves and protective glasses are crucial.Momentary Repairs
Protect Broken Glass:
Use tape to hold shattered glass pieces in location.Cover the location with cardboard or plastic for extra security.
Seal Leaks:
Use weather condition removing or caulk to momentarily seal leaks.If there are larger openings, utilize plywood to cover them until irreversible repairs are possible.Irreversible Repair Options

Research Local Services: Search online for repair services in the area.Inspect Reviews: Look for customer reviews and testimonials.Get Estimates: Contact several services for quotes.Verify Certifications: Ensure the company is accredited and insured.Inquire About Emergency Services: Confirm if they offer fast reaction times for immediate repairs.FAQs About Emergency Window RepairWhat should I do if my window breaks in the evening?
If you're facing a broken window throughout the night, prioritize safety initially. If there's any danger of injury, tape up the broken glass for stability and cover the location with a blanket until morning, when you can set up repair work.
Can I repair my window myself?
While some small issues may be workable for a DIY technique, substantial damages like replacing glass panes or frame repairs need professional knowledge to ensure your safety and correct sealing.
How long does window repair typically take?
The time for repair work can differ based upon the damage extent. Small repair work may take a couple of hours, while more significant replacements might take a day or more.
Just how much does emergency window repair expense?
Costs can vary widely depending upon numerous elements, consisting of product, labor, and the level of the damage. Usually, standard repair work can vary from ₤ 100 to ₤ 300, while replacements might escalate into the low thousands.
